Cannabidiol, or CBD, is the lesser-known child of the cannabis sativa plant. It is advertised as providing relief for anxiety, depression and post-traumatic stress disorder. Consumers can reap health benefits from the plant without the high or the munchies that comes with smoking marijuana.

As with any drug, there is a risk of potential side effects. While researchers are continuing to investigate CBD, evidence suggests it is safe and tolerable when a person uses these products appropriately.
While cannabis is still banned in many parts of the states, hemp-derived CBD products are legal across the country.
